Raquel Rodriguez discussed her future in-ring plans during a session with TMZ Inside The Ring, specifically targeting a high-profile matchup for WrestleMania 42. While she acknowledged her previous history with Stephanie Vaquer, Rodriguez noted that she wants to allow Liv Morgan to handle that rivalry independently. Instead, Rodriguez has set her sights on Jade Cargill following several recent confrontations on Friday Night SmackDown.
“Jade has been very annoying to me these past couple of SmackDowns that we’ve attended. I feel like she’s been very disrespectful to the Judgment Day girlies. I feel like she’s just Jade. It’s, you know, It’s Jade being Jade. So I would love to hand her a good old-fashioned can of ass-whooping and, yeah, I’m able to on the WrestleMania stage too,” Rodriguez said.
The powerhouse performer detailed a physical vision for the potential contest, expressing a desire to utilize her signature strength against the former TBS Champion. Rodriguez noted that she is no longer interested in “playing nice” and wants to demonstrate her more vicious side on the biggest stage of the year.
“I would love that. I would love to just grab her by her hair and drag around the ring… yeah, I think I could do that,” Rodriguez added.
Before reaching the WrestleMania stage, Rodriguez must first navigate a triple threat qualifying match on the February 23 episode of Monday Night Raw against IYO SKY and Kairi Sane. Rodriguez expressed extreme confidence heading into the bout, stating that she intends to use her signature “Tejana Bomb” to secure a spot in the Elimination Chamber in Chicago.
